ELLSWORTH COUNTY -Law enforcement authorities in Ellsworth County are investigating a reported accidental shooting.
Just before 4p.m. on Thursday, first responders were dispatched to a resident in the 400 Block of 30th Street in the city of Wilson, according to police chief Bob Doepp.
Police found a teenage boy injured with a gunshot wound to the chest from a .22 caliber rifle.
The teen was transported to the hospital in Salina and then flown to a Wichita hospital.
He is expected to make a full recovery, according to the police department.
“It appears to be accidental but we are still considering everything,” said Doepp.
